Kanher Dam, is an earthfill and gravity dam on Wenna river near Satara in state of Maharashtra in India.

The height of the dam above lowest foundation is 50.34 m (165.2 ft) while the length is 1,954 m (6,411 ft). The volume content is 6,308 km3 (1,513 cu mi) and gross storage capacity is 286,000.00 km3 (68,615.05 cu mi).[1]
